I would note that I am *not* using explicitly enabling LTO. These packages fail to link with the rather mundane flags:

  CFLAGS="-march=native -O3 -ggdb -pipe"
  CXXFLAGS="${CFLAGS}"
  LDFLAGS="-Wl,-O2 -Wl,--as-needed"

/usr/lib/gcc/x86_64-pc-linux-gnu/8.2.0/../../../../x86_64-pc-linux-gnu/bin/ld: warning: discarding version information for __pthread_key_create@GLIBC_2.2.5, defined in unused shared library /lib64/libpthread.so.0 (linked with --as-needed)
/usr/lib/gcc/x86_64-pc-linux-gnu/8.2.0/../../../../x86_64-pc-linux-gnu/bin/ld: error: treating warnings as errors
collect2: error: ld returned 1 exit status
Comment 4 Michael Palimaka (kensington) gentoo-dev 2018-08-19 13:53:24 UTC
CCing toolchain to get insight into this linker warning.

In the meantime, we could consider removing -Wl,--fatal-warnings from KDECompilerSettings.cmake in ECM to avoid triggering a build failure when this warning is encountered.

Next binutils (future 2.32 release) will not warn about it by default (guarded by --warn-drop-version):
    https://sourceware.org/git/gitweb.cgi?p=binutils-gdb.git;a=commitdiff;h=3a12c78d1491c4877928e7294c8cdbe8171dfeed
